Job Description
Nichols Cauley is a leading financial services platform recognized among the Top 120 Firms by Inside Public Accounting. We are honored to be named one of Accounting Today's Best Firms to Work For and Best Firms for Young Accountants, a testament to our unwavering commitment to professional excellence, career development, and a collaborative, supportive culture. As we continue to grow, we offer talented professionals a dynamic environment where innovation is encouraged, teamwork is valued, and long-term success is a shared goal. If you are seeking a rewarding career with a firm dedicated to your growth and success, we encourage you to apply to join our team. Key Responsibilities Perform day-to-day bookkeeping and general ledger maintenance for clients using accounting software Assist in preparing monthly, quarterly, and annual financial statements Support payroll processing and payroll tax filings for clients Assist with the preparation of individual, corporate, and partnership tax returns Reconcile bank accounts and perform other account reconciliations Communicate professionally and promptly with clients regarding routine transactions and questions Support senior accountants and managers in various accounting and advisory projects Maintain confidentiality and integrity with sensitive client information Stay current on accounting principles, firm policies, and industry best practices Qualifications Bachelor's degree in Accounting Strong attention to detail and organizational skills Excellent written and verbal communication abilities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, Word, Outlook) Familiarity with accounting and bookkeeping software is a plus Ability to prioritize, multitask, and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ment Commitment to professional ethics and client confidentiality
Benefits:
Compensation commensurate with experience 401K plan (with up to 4% salary paid employer contributions) Medical Insurance Dental Insurance Flexible work arrangements Generous Paid time-off & Holidays Flexible spending accounts Employee life insurance Supplemental life insurance for Employee and Dependents Long-term Disability insurance Short-term Disability insurance Accidental death & dismemberment insurance Paid parental leave Childcare Assistance Why Nichols Cauley?
